Color Conversions
| Format | Value | CSS Usage | |
|---|---|---|---|
| HSL | hsl(337, 23%, 65%) | color: hsl(337, 23%, 65%) | |
| HEX | #BA91A1 | color: #BA91A1 | |
| RGB | rgb(186, 145, 161) | color: rgb(186, 145, 161) | |
| CMYK | cmyk(0%, 22%, 13%, 27%) | — | |
| HSV | hsv(337, 22%, 73%) | — | |
| HWB | hwb(337 57% 27%) | color: hwb(337 57% 27%) | |
| OKLCH | oklch(0.6998 0.0537 353.27) | color: oklch(0.6998 0.0537 353.27) | |
| Lab | lab(64.37 18.01 -2.47) | color: lab(64.37 18.01 -2.47) | |
| LCH | lch(64.37 18.18 352.19) | color: lch(64.37 18.18 352.19) |

What colors go well with #BA91A1?
The complementary color is HSL(157, 23%, 65%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 337°, 97°, and 217°. For analogous combinations, try hues 307° and 7°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
